Abstract
The invention discloses a kind of audio identification method to set up, the method to set up includes:When collecting audio file, the identification information of setpoint frequency is set in the setting position of the audio file, so that using terminal is when using the audio file, can the audio file be used according to the identification information judgment.The invention also discloses a kind of audio identification application method, terminal and computer-readable recording medium, by implementing such scheme, identification information effectively can be set in audio file, and can audio file legal be used according to identification information judgment during using audio file, avoid audio file stolen or falsely use, be effectively improved the security of audio file.

First embodiment of the invention, a kind of audio identification method to set up, applied to acquisition terminal, as shown in Fig. 2 this method
Including step in detail below:
Step S101, when collecting audio file, the mark of setpoint frequency is set in the setting position of audio file
Information, so that using terminal is when using audio file, can audio file be used according to identification information judgment.
Identification information includes:Identification information;Wherein, identification information is setpoint frequency;The quantity of setpoint frequency be one or
It is multiple.
In some embodiments of the invention, setpoint frequency is more than 20KHz, or less than 20Hz.
It is more than 20KHz or small because the earshot of people is 20Hz~20KHz, therefore by the set of frequency of identification information
In 20Hz, identification information can be set in audio file in the case where not influenceing audio file and playing.
In some embodiments of the invention, the duration of the identification information of setpoint frequency is not specifically limited.
In some embodiments of the invention, the setting position in audio file is not specifically limited, in audio file
Setting position can be one, or it is multiple.
In some embodiments of the invention, in the case of being multiple in setting position, can be set in each setting position
The identification information of a setpoint frequency is put, the identification information of multiple setpoint frequencies can also be set in each setting position, also may be used
To set the identification information of a setpoint frequency in one or more setting positions and be set in other one or more setting positions
Put the identification information of multiple setpoint frequencies.
By setting one or more setpoint frequencies in one or more of the audio file collected setting position
Identification information, can using the audio file when, according to one or more of audio file setting position set one or
The identification information of multiple setpoint frequencies, whether using the audio file legal, avoid and falsely use or usurp audio file, have if judging
Improve to effect the security of audio file;The security setting steps of audio file are greatly simplify, effectively increase use
Use the Consumer's Experience of audio file safely in family.
Such as:When collecting audio file, one setpoint frequency 27KHz of setting in the setting position of audio file
Identification information, so that using terminal is when using audio file, according to the identification information in setpoint frequency 27KHz identification information
Can 27KHz judge use audio file;Wherein, identification information includes:Identification information;Identification information is setpoint frequency 27KHz.
